Methods of Leak Detection
The methods of leak detection vary depending on the industry and equipment used. Some common methods include:
- Tap testing: This involves inserting a needle into a pipe to detect leaks.
- Ultrasonic testing: This uses high-frequency sound waves to detect leaks in pipes or ducts.
- Dye testing: This involves injecting dye into a pipeline and observing its movement to detect leaks.

Technologies Used in Leak Detection
Modern leak detection technologies include:
- Online leak detectors: These use advanced sensors and algorithms to detect leaks remotely.
- Leak detection software: This allows for real-time monitoring and reporting of leak activity.
- Smart pipes: These are equipped with sensors and communication devices that can detect leaks and alert authorities or users in case of an issue.
